Antibody discovery is the process of identifying and isolating antibodies that bind specifically to a biological target (antigen), typically for therapeutic, diagnostic, or research applications.

Fusion Antibodies provide multiple antibody discovery platforms for broader epitope coverage, reducing risk, and greater flexibility than having to rely on a single method.
Our capacity to integrate immune-derived, display-based, and computational methods will maximise hit quality and therapeutic relevance. We improves the probability of identifying therapeutic antibodies with optimal biological and developability profiles.

| Description | Key advantage | |
|---|---|---|
| Mouse Hybridoma (hybridoma antibody discovery) | Classic immunisation-based monoclonal antibody generation followed by screening | Robust, widely validated, cost-effective |
| Rabbit B-cell cloning (rabbit discovery) | Rabbit immunisation followed by B-cell screening for monoclonal antibodies | Higher affinity, broader epitope recognition |
| Phage display (OptiPhage®) | Antibody library screening using phage-displayed recombinant antibodies | Fully human antibody fragments, well-suited for producing modular components for bispecifics. |
| Mammalian display (OptiMAL®) | Cell-surface display of full-length human IgG | Native-format antibodies without humanisation and incorporating developability screening |
| AI/ML-guided discovery (AI/ML-ab™) | In silico antibody library design and mammalian display screening with wet-lab validation | Accelerates hit identification and epitope prioritisation |
